But why we give so much aid to a developed first world country is bizarre.
Seriously? It's bizarre?

Israel is a friendly country, that is willing to help us out with our dirty work, for a price. We pay that price. They do our dirty work. Giving them money isn't bizarre, it's based in a long historical tradition of subsidizing allies. Prussia and Austria were "first world" countries during the Napoleonic Wars, and they were given huge piles of cash to help the British fight the French. It's how things have always been done.
